THE
MEEK ARE BLESSED BY GOD
(Matthew 5:5)
…When our world
thinks of conquest it thinks in terms of power, __strength__ and
aggressiveness. The more you assert yourself, the more you show your strength
the more likely you are to succeed. Our world __loves__ the so -called
power brokers like Donald Trump, who aggressively crush any who get in their
way.
…But
Jesus doesn’t mess with any of this. He cuts right through all of it, turning
the world upside down by telling that only the meek will inherit the earth.
…Meekness is essential. Without it you will never
__enter__
heaven. Yet many people do not even know what it is.
THREE
CONSIDERATIONS HELPING US TO SEE OUR NEED TO BE MEEK PEOPLE.
…FOR
THIS
__FAMILY__
CHARACTERISTIC IS PRODUCED IN YOU BY THE HOLY SPIRIT IF YOU ARE SAVED.
I. It Is
Essential For Us To Understand The Meaning of “Meekness.”
…This
is often confused with other qualities.
A.
Negatively:
What Meekness is not:
1.
It is not a
__natural__
born personality quality, like a disposition.
2.
It does not
mean __weakness__
in person. It is not the attitude of “peace at any price.” Nor is it the
spirit of compromise. NO.
B.
Positively:
the word means “soft” or “gentle.” It was used of
__colts__
whose natural spirits were broken by a trainer so that they could do work. It
is really “__power__
under control.”
1.
It carries the
idea of a quiet, tenderhearted __submission__,
knowing that “ God is working all things out for the good.”
2.
Meekness is
compatible with great strength, power, and authority. “Martyrs are meek, they
are __not__
weak.” Dying for the truth takes great strength.
3.
Meekness
controls our __lips__,
so that we don’t say the things we may feel like saying. Bunyon, “He that is
down, need fear no fall.”
4.
You must first
be “poor in spirit” and “mourn” before you are meek.
5.
Meekness
reflects the absence of __pride__.
It does no revenge, it does not assert itself. Jesus is our great example in
this.
6.
Really, the
meek person is __amazed__
that God and man can think of him as well as they do, for he knows the truth
about himself, and it is not pretty.
II. Note The
Definite __Results__
That Meekness Produces.
A.
The General
result of meekness in our lives is ”blessedness.” This is that inner
__happiness__
and joy that fills our soul. God gives His
__own__
joy and happiness to us.
B.
The more
specific result of meekness involves an inheritance…”inherit the earth.” (Psalm
37:11)
1.
For the
present this means that there will be a contentedness in our
__hearts__.
2.
In the future,
it means those of this kingdom will regain paradise lost in Genesis 3. This
will be forever!!!!
…One
day, Jesus will reign over all the earth and we will
__share__
in the kingdom.
III.
Meekness
Displayed In The Lives Of Some Great Men.
A.
Joseph, after
having suffered so much from the hands of his brothers, is meek when he refuses
revenge, and treats his brothers __kindly__
choosing to see the unseen hand of the Lord.
…”You
meant it for evil, but God meant it for good.” (Genesis 50:20)
B.
When Abraham
allowed Lot to choose the best land, he was meek, not assertive.
C.
Moses is
called the meekest man of his generation. (Numbers 12:3) This was
__not__
his natural disposition. Early he was self-willed and self-sufficient. 40
years in the desert made him…
…In
Number 12, he marries a
__black__
woman from Africa and his family did not like it. He does not defend himself,
rather allows God to take care of it, and God does.
D.
Jesus tells us
that He is “__meek__
and lowly in heart.” (Matt 11:29) You can see it in His reaction to others.
Meekness is the __only__
personality quality about Himself to which He drew special attention.
Philippians 2:5-8, paints a beautiful picture of meekness which is clearly seen
in His __total__
submission to His Father.
